Export Marketing and Development Grant (EMDG)

The EMDG program provides matched funding to eligible Australian small and medium enterprises (SMEs) to market and promote their goods and services internationally. Administered by Austrade, the program now operates as an upfront grant agreement — giving exporters funding certainty before they begin their activities.

Current status: Round 4 is closed to applications. Funding of up to $104.5 million will be available for 2025–26. Grant tiers range from $20,000–$80,000 per year depending on your export stage.

European Union Research & Development Grant

The European Union offers research and innovation funding through Horizon Europe (2021–2027), the EU's largest ever R&D program with a budget of approximately €95.5 billion. Australian entities may be eligible to participate as partners in certain Horizon Europe calls, following Australia's association agreement with the program.

Boosting Female Founders Initiative

Female founders of startup businesses can receive grants between $25,000 and $480,000 to launch and scale their businesses into domestic and global markets. The program provides co-contribution funding (up to 50%, or up to 70% for eligible businesses) to help women entrepreneurs grow their startups.

Current status: Round 2 is closed. Further rounds are expected. Register your interest to be notified when applications reopen.

Accelerating Commercialisation Grant

The Accelerating Commercialisation program provided expert guidance and matched grant funding to help businesses get novel products, processes and services to market. This program is now closed — new applications closed on 9 May 2023.

Minimum Viable Product (MVP) Grant

MVP grants support pre-revenue technology startups in progressing from proof of concept to a working minimum viable product. Grants cover up to 50% of approved project costs up to $25,000. Availability and eligibility varies by state — check with KP Retail for the latest information.

Export Finance Australia

Export Finance Australia (EFA) is a government-owned financial institution that provides finance, bonds and insurance solutions for Australian exporters where commercial banks cannot help. Products include export loans, working capital finance and the Small Business Export Loan. KP Retail helps Australian exporters identify and access the right EFA product.
